This market refers to the tennis match between Pablo Hermoso and John Echeverria in the ITF Men Martos, originally scheduled for June 10, 2026 at 10:00AM ET. This market will resolve to 'Pablo Hermoso' if Pablo Hermoso advances against John Echeverria. This market will resolve to 'John Echeverria' if John Echeverria advances against Pablo Hermoso. If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50. If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ances. If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50. The primary resolution source will be official information from the International Tennis Federation (ITF). Echeverria, currently ranked around No. 551, brings slightly more recent competitive experience on the ITF circuit, including matches earlier this year, while Hermoso has competed in similar Futures-level events with limited standout results. Both enter with recent losses on their schedules, and no confirmed injuries or withdrawals have been reported ahead of the 14:00 UTC start. The hard surface favors baseline consistency and serve effectiveness, factors that often decide tight ITF encounters where rankings gaps remain modest and upsets occur regularly.
